Rada ratifies memo with Germany on EUR 500 mln loan to restore Donbas infrastructure
The Verkhovna Rada of Ukraine has ratified a memorandum of intent between the governments of Ukraine and Germany on the provision of a EUR 500 million loan for the restoration of infrastructure in eastern Ukraine and for the needs of the state budget's general fund.
A total of 266 lawmakers voted for relevant bill No. 0048 in parliament on Wednesday.
The memorandum was signed in Berlin on April 1, 2015.
According to explanatory notes to the bill, the ratification of this memorandum will create a legal framework for Ukraine to receive a EUR 300 million loan from KfW Group of Banks to finance first priority projects in the construction and modernization of infrastructure in the eastern regions of Ukraine in the following fields: transport, energy, heating, energy efficiency, water supply and drainage, social infrastructure, and housing construction and reconstruction.
The memorandum also envisages the provision of EUR 200 million in financing for the needs of the state budget's general fund.
